### Checklist: Request tracing across microservices

Verify trace propagation before sign-off. Every hop in the Larkmont mesh must forward the trace header unchanged; the gateway, the Orchard billing service, and the fan-out workers all had regressions here before. Run the synthetic probe end-to-end, confirm a single unbroken trace in the Spanviewer dashboard, and check no service starts a new root span mid-chain. Sampling stays at 10% in prod. Record the probe's trace token below this item for future maintainers.

pipeline stamp: htk3_cc5

Regarding the seat-map renderer for the Amberline Playhouse client: the per-request tile cache is unbounded, which a hostile client could exploit by requesting arbitrary zoom levels to exhaust memory. Please cap cache entries and enforce a zoom range server-side rather than trusting the widget. I've drafted limits consistent with our largest venue layouts. The proposed constants appear below.

constants for bawif-kawif:
QUOTAS = {
    "ulaael": 5,
    "holael": 10,
}

## Ticket: Audit-Log Viewer env misconfig (Plugin SDK)

Plugin authors report the Ledgerpane audit-log viewer 403s on every query in the sandbox. Root cause: sandbox env file was regenerated without the viewer's read token. Symptoms: empty log panes, repeated auth retries, no crash. Fix: rebuild your local env from the current template, restart the viewer host, and add the token line directly below this ticket reference.

sealed setting: RELAY_SECRET5=82864

**FAQ: Can I use the canteen on Level 2?**

Yes. The Level 2 canteen at Torvane Place is shared with our neighbours, Ashgrove Metrics, under a joint-services arrangement. Visiting contractors working for Pellam Systems may use it between 11:30 and 14:00 on weekdays. Trays must stay within the seating area, and the Ashgrove side of the servery is card-payment only. Access from the contractor corridor is via the grey door marked C2. Enter the code below on the keypad to unlock it.

badge for hahif-faweg: bdg-VF-9